Description from the seller

Artist: Renzo Bergamo (Italian, 1934–2004)
Title, year and technique: Untitled, early 1990s (Period: Aesthetics of Chaos). Mixed media, pencil, pastels and graphite on paper.
Dimensions: Image and sheet: 42 cm wide by 29.7 cm
No frame.
Details of signature: Signed with the initial "R" in pencil/graphite at the corners of the work.
Edition: Original unique work (one-off / sketch).
Provenance: Private Collection, direct provenance from the Artist's collection (Caterina Arancio Bergamo).
Documentation: Accompanied by the original paper archival card of the Renzo Bergamo Archive - Milan (ID no. 1036). On the back of the sheet is the original ink stamp of the Archive bearing the signature and the catalog number 1036 handwritten.
Conditions: Overall excellent condition. Very good preservation, vivid and saturated colors, paper perfectly intact.
Shipping: The work will be shipped flat (not rolled) inside a high-strength protective rigid packaging, via trackable express courier.
Supplementary information
The work belongs to the Chaos Aesthetics cycle conceived by Renzo Bergamo in the early 1990s. It is a unique sketch/study rich in pigment and dynamic energy, fully representative of the artist's exploration of cosmic forces and theoretical physics.
